BrCreationID
class description - source file - inheritance tree
public:
BrCreationID BrCreationID()
BrCreationID BrCreationID(TObject* Creator)
BrCreationID BrCreationID(BrCreationID&)
virtual void ~BrCreationID()
static TClass* Class()
virtual const TString& GetClassName() const
virtual const Version_t GetClassVersion() const
virtual const TInetAddress& GetHost() const
virtual const TDatime& GetTime() const
virtual const UInt_t GetUser() const
virtual TClass* IsA() const
virtual void Print(Option_t* option) const
virtual void ShowMembers(TMemberInspector& insp, char* parent)
virtual void Streamer(TBuffer& b)
void StreamerNVirtual(TBuffer& b)
private:
TDatime fTime time when object was created
TString fCreatorClassName Class name of creating object
Version_t fCreatorClassVersion Class version of creating object
TInetAddress fHost Host running creating process
UInt_t fUserID User ID for creating process
BrCreationID is a bookkeeping class that stores some
key information about the creation of a BrDataObject
BrCreationID()
Default constructor. Does nothing.
Don't use this constructor unless you have to and know
what you are doing
Use BrCreationID(TObject *Creator) instead.
BrCreationID(TObject *Creator)
Constructor. Fills the data members of the BrCreationID
based on the TObject pointer and some TSystem calls
~BrCreationID()
Destructor. Delete BrCreationID
void Print(Option_t* option) const
Print creator information.
Inline Functions
const TDatime& GetTime() const
const TString& GetClassName() const
const Version_t GetClassVersion() const
const TInetAddress& GetHost() const
const UInt_t GetUser() const
TClass* Class()
TClass* IsA() const
void ShowMembers(TMemberInspector& insp, char* parent)
void Streamer(TBuffer& b)
void StreamerNVirtual(TBuffer& b)
BrCreationID BrCreationID(BrCreationID&)
|